Output d3f31c35f51c01a00d6427a10d959add542b0efaf2598fb35d906f441178e832:6

value
40900894
script pubkey
OP_0 OP_PUSHBYTES_32 14cf5b00cd6eb46fbb2dae793374b4e46a9bd5b99a77f5db6ae93a25514b39f4
address
bc1qzn84kqxdd66xlwed4eunxa95u34fh4denfmltkm2ayaz252t886qme3x54
transaction
d3f31c35f51c01a00d6427a10d959add542b0efaf2598fb35d906f441178e832
spent
true